La Rioja announces 35,000 euro grants to promote cycling
Por FactBox Admin

The Official Gazette of La Rioja publishes in issue 178, dated September 16, 2026, the 2026 call for grants intended for activities promoting the use of the bicycle as a means of transport in the community. The measure, approved by Resolution 744/2026, of September 10, of the Department of Local Policy, Infrastructure and Fight against Depopulation, has a total budget of 35,000 euros and is processed under a competitive bidding regime.
The call develops the regulatory bases approved by Order STE/52/2022, of August 10, of the Department of Sustainability, Ecological Transition and Government Spokesperson, and is published as an extract in compliance with articles 17.3.b and 20.8.a of the General Subsidies Law 38/2003, of November 17. The full text is available in the National Subsidies Database (BDNS: 928960) and in the Electronic Office of the Government of La Rioja.
Beneficiaries and eligible activities
Private, non-profit entities, institutions, and organizations that carry out the activities to be financed within the scope of the Autonomous Community of La Rioja may apply for the grants. Public sector entities and those subject to the prohibitions of article 13 of Decree 14/2006, of February 16, regulating the legal regime of subsidies in the Riojan public sector, are excluded.
The following activities are considered eligible:
- Preparation and execution of informative and training actions, such as learning and improvement courses in the use of the bicycle, maintenance, repair or customization courses, exhibitions, talks, conferences, seminars, festivals, cycling marches, and the promotion of road safety.
- Drafting, translation, and publication of written and audiovisual materials.
- Conducting research on bicycle mobility.
- Organization of flea markets for the purchase and sale of second-hand bicycles and equipment.
- Attendance of members of the beneficiary entities at coordination or debate meetings with other public and private entities, or at training and study events.
- Other analogous activities.
Activities of a sporting nature are expressly excluded.
Amount, deadline, and processing
The total amount of the call amounts to 35,000 euros, which will be charged to budget item 09.02.4411.480.03 for the 2026 financial year. The actions subject to the grant must start and end between November 1, 2025, and October 31, 2026.
The application period is 15 business days starting from the day following the publication of the summary in the Official Gazette of La Rioja. The official application form is available on the Government of La Rioja website, in the Transport thematic area.
Regarding justification, activities already completed by the date of the call’s publication must submit the supporting documentation along with the application; the remainder must do so within 10 business days from the completion of the activity. The notification of grant or denial will be carried out through the Electronic Notifications system of the electronic office of the Government of La Rioja. The resolution was signed in Logroño on September 10, 2026, by the counselor Daniel Osés Ramírez.
A commitment to sustainable mobility
The call reinforces the regional strategy to promote the bicycle as a daily transport alternative, with a budget that allows non-profit associations and collectives to finance training, research, and awareness campaigns. For Riojan entities, it represents an opportunity to obtain public funding for active mobility projects, within a competitive framework that prioritizes the quality and impact of the submitted proposals.
